He moves like a song and her eyes drink him in. Ellen watches her baby girl and John's boy, wondering how long until Jo follows him out the door. It's a cold, hard world, and she knows Dean won't take care of her girl. He's only got room for his brother in his heart. Everyone else falls to the wayside—always have, always will.
Ellen knows Dean's tricks—they're the same ones Bill pulled on her, years ago. Dean's better than Bill was; missed his calling as an actor, the boy did. He's all sleek cat and knight in shining armor. Ain't a girl in the world that's got a chance against his sunshine-grin and brilliant eyes.
She doesn't begrudge him his fun; Jo should know better. From the moment those boys broke into her Roadhouse, Ellen could see they had only each other. She can't figure out how her daughter missed it.
Of course, it's not the kind of thing a young woman would want to see. Two boys like that? Dean's been taken since he was just a little thing, if Ellen's guess is right.
Pity, though. Boy looks like that—the grandchildren would all be absolutely gorgeous.
